组件/文本框
您可以通过设置以下属性来控制文本框按钮的外观:
控件可以增大或减小文本框的大小大小
属性的成员Telerik.Blazor.ThemeConstants.TextBox.Size
类:
类成员 |
手动声明 |
小 |
sm |
媒介 |
医学博士 |
大 |
lg |
@{var fields = typeof(Telerik.Blazor.ThemeConstants.TextBox.Size) . getfields (System.Reflection.BindingFlags. size)。Public | System.Reflection.BindingFlags.Static | system . reflection . bindingflags . flathierarchy) . where (field => field。IsLiteral && !field.IsInitOnly).ToList();@foreach (var字段中的字段){字符串大小= field. getvalue (null).ToString();< div风格= "浮动:左;保证金:20 px;>< TelerikTextBox @bind-Value="@TextBoxValue" Size="@size">
}} @code{私有字符串TextBoxValue {get;设置;}}
的圆形的
属性应用这个特性
CSS规则,以实现文本框的边缘弯曲。您可以将其设置为Telerik.Blazor.ThemeConstants.TextBox.Rounded
类:
类成员 |
手动声明 |
小 |
sm |
媒介 |
医学博士 |
大 |
lg |
完整的 |
完整的 |
@*舍入属性的内置值。*@ @{var fields = typeof(telerik . blazor . themeconstants . textbox . round) . getfields (System.Reflection.BindingFlags.)Public | System.Reflection.BindingFlags.Static | system . reflection . bindingflags . flathierarchy) . where (field => field。IsLiteral && !field.IsInitOnly).ToList();@foreach (var字段中的字段){字符串四舍五入= field. getvalue (null).ToString();< div风格= "浮动:左;保证金:20 px;>< TelerikTextBox @bind-Value="@TextBoxValue"舍入="@舍入">
}} @code{私有字符串TextBoxValue {get;设置;}}
的FillMode
控制TelerikTextBox的填充方式。您可以将其设置为Telerik.Blazor.ThemeConstants.TextBox.FillMode
类:
类成员 |
结果 |
固体 默认值 |
固体 |
平 |
平 |
大纲 |
大纲 |
@*这些都是内置的填充模式*@ @{var字段= typeof(Telerik.Blazor.ThemeConstants.TextBox.FillMode) . getfields (System.Reflection.BindingFlags.)Public | System.Reflection.BindingFlags.Static | system . reflection . bindingflags . flathierarchy) . where (field => field。IsLiteral && !field.IsInitOnly).ToList();@foreach (var字段中的字段){字符串fillMode = field. getvalue (null).ToString();< div风格= "浮动:左;保证金:20 px;">< span>@fillMode
ThemeBuilder是一个web应用程序,使您能够创建新的主题和自定义现有的。你所做的每一个改变几乎都会立刻被可视化。一旦你完成了UI组件的样式,你就可以导出一个包含主题样式的ZIP文件,并在Blazor应用程序中使用它们。